🔍 Step 1: Diagnose the Real Growth Blocker (Not Just ‘Water & Light’)
Most rubber plant care guides stop at ‘water when dry, give bright light.’ But stunted growth is rarely about watering frequency—it’s about physiological capacity. A 2023 University of Florida IFAS greenhouse trial tracked 142 indoor Ficus elastica specimens across 12 months and found that only 11% of non-growing plants had actual overwatering; 63% were suffering from chronic low-light adaptation, 19% from root confinement masquerading as ‘happy in its pot’, and 7% from seasonal dormancy misdiagnosis (i.e., fertilizing during true winter dormancy).
Start here—not with your watering can, but with your eyes and hands:
- Light audit: Hold your smartphone camera (no flash) 12 inches from the leaf surface. If the screen shows visible grain or requires ISO >800 to capture detail, light is insufficient for growth (Ficus elastica needs ≥1,500 lux for sustained photosynthesis—equivalent to bright, indirect light near an east or south window, not across a room).
- Root check: Gently tilt the plant and slide it sideways from its pot. If roots are circling tightly, forming a dense mat on the bottom, or protruding from drainage holes, it’s pot-bound—even if the soil feels moist. Root-bound plants allocate energy to survival, not growth.
- Seasonal sync: Rubber plants enter true dormancy in December–February (in Northern Hemisphere), triggered by photoperiod (day length), not temperature. If you’re fertilizing or repotting now, you’re stressing—not supporting—the plant.

🌱 Step 2: The Light Fix That Actually Works (Spoiler: Windowsill ≠ Enough)
Bright, indirect light is the #1 non-negotiable for rubber plant growth—but ‘indirect’ is widely misunderstood. Many place plants 6 feet from a south window, assuming filtered light suffices. Reality? Light intensity drops 75% at 3 feet and 90% at 6 feet (per USDA ARS light decay studies). And sheer curtains? They block 40–60% of PAR (Photosynthetically Active Radiation)—the light spectrum plants use.
Here’s what works—backed by spectral data:
- Morning sun + reflective surfaces: An east-facing windowsill with a white wall or mirror opposite delivers 2,200–2,800 lux—ideal for growth. South-facing is excellent if filtered by a 30% shade cloth or positioned 12–18 inches back with a light-diffusing blind.
- Supplemental lighting (when natural light fails): Use full-spectrum LED grow lights (3,000–6,500K CCT) placed 12–18 inches above the canopy. Run 10–12 hours/day. A 24W panel (e.g., Sansi 24W) boosts growth rates by 40% in low-light apartments (RHS 2022 trial).
- Avoid the ‘greenhouse illusion’: Don’t move your rubber plant outdoors in summer unless acclimated over 10 days. Sudden UV exposure burns leaves and triggers stress hormones that suppress meristem activity for weeks.

💧 Step 3: Watering, Humidity & Soil—The Triad Most Get Wrong
‘Let soil dry out between waterings’ is incomplete advice. Rubber plants don’t just need dry-to-moist cycles—they need consistent oxygen availability in the root zone. Compacted, peat-heavy soils stay damp on the surface but suffocate roots below, halting cytokinin production (the hormone driving cell division and growth).
Optimize your medium and moisture regime:
- Soil recipe (non-negotiable): 40% coarse perlite or pumice, 30% high-quality potting mix (look for compost, coconut coir, and mycorrhizae), 20% orchid bark (¼” pieces), 10% horticultural charcoal. This mix drains in under 90 seconds yet retains humidity around roots. Avoid generic ‘houseplant soil’—it compacts within 4 months.
- Watering rhythm: Insert a wooden chopstick 3 inches deep. If it comes out clean and dry, water thoroughly until 20% drains from the bottom. Then wait—don’t water on a schedule. In winter, this may be every 14–21 days; in summer with strong light, every 5–7 days.
- Humidity myth bust: Rubber plants tolerate 30% RH (typical heated home) just fine. Growth stalls when humidity fluctuates wildly (e.g., misting daily then dropping to 25% overnight). Instead, group with other plants or use a small humidifier on a timer (40–50% RH steady >60% spikes).

🌿 Step 4: Feeding, Pruning & Repotting—Timing Is Everything
Fertilizer isn’t ‘plant food’—it’s a precision signal. Applying nitrogen during dormancy doesn’t boost growth; it leaches nutrients and salts the soil. Likewise, pruning at the wrong time redirects energy away from growth flushes.
Follow this evidence-based calendar:
- Fertilizing: Only during active growth (March–October in the Northern Hemisphere). Use a balanced, urea-free fertilizer (e.g., Dyna-Gro Foliage Pro 9-3-6) diluted to ¼ strength, applied with every other watering. Skip entirely November–February. Over-fertilization causes salt buildup—a top cause of leaf drop and growth arrest (confirmed by 73% of ASPCA Poison Control cases involving Ficus toxicity symptoms).
- Pruning: Cut just above a leaf node only in late spring (May–June) to stimulate branching. Never prune in fall/winter—wounds heal slowly, inviting infection and diverting energy from root maintenance.
- Repotting: Every 2–3 years in early spring (March–April), only if roots are circling or lifting the plant. Use a pot 1–2 inches wider—never double the size. Larger pots hold excess moisture, promoting root rot. Always prune circling roots by 20% and dust cut ends with cinnamon (natural fungicide).
Table: Rubber Plant Growth Reset Timeline (Northern Hemisphere)
| Month | Growth Phase | Key Actions | Avoid |
|---|---|---|---|
| March–April | Emergence | Repot if root-bound; begin fertilizing; increase light exposure gradually | Heavy pruning; cold drafts; unfiltered south light |
| May–July | Vigorous Growth | Feed every other watering; rotate weekly; wipe leaves monthly | Overwatering; moving frequently; high-salt fertilizers |
| August–September | Consolidation | Reduce feeding to monthly; increase airflow; inspect for pests | New soil mixes; drastic light changes; misting |
| October–February | Dormancy | Water only when bone-dry 3" down; no fertilizer; maintain stable temps (65–75°F) | Repotting; pruning; supplemental light (unless truly low-light); cold windows |
Frequently Asked Questions
Why is my rubber plant growing tall but not bushy?
This is classic etiolation—caused by insufficient light intensity or duration. When light is too weak, the plant stretches vertically to reach photons, sacrificing lateral bud development. Move it closer to a bright window or add supplemental LED lighting for 10–12 hours daily. Prune the main stem tip in May to force branching—new growth will emerge from nodes below the cut.
Can I propagate my rubber plant to encourage new growth on the parent?
Yes—but only via air layering or stem cuttings taken in spring. Cutting a branch doesn’t ‘stimulate’ the parent; however, removing a dominant apical bud (topmost growing point) releases auxin inhibition, allowing dormant lateral buds to activate. For best results, air-layer a mature stem in April: wound the stem, wrap with damp sphagnum moss, cover with plastic, and wait 4–6 weeks for roots. Then sever and pot.
Is my rubber plant toxic to pets—and does that affect its care?
Yes—Ficus elastica contains ficin and psoralen, which cause oral irritation, vomiting, and drooling in cats and dogs (ASPCA Toxicity Level: Mild to Moderate). This doesn’t change care—but it means never use chemical pesticides or systemic insecticides. Opt for neem oil soil drenches or insecticidal soap sprays. Also, avoid placing where pets can knock it over (heavy ceramic pots recommended).
My rubber plant has aerial roots—should I bury them or trim them?
Aerial roots are normal and beneficial—they absorb ambient humidity and anchor the plant in nature. In homes, they’re mostly decorative. Do not bury them unless repotting (then gently tuck into fresh soil). Trimming is safe but unnecessary unless they’re snagging on furniture. Never cut into the main stem—only trim aerial roots at their base with sterilized scissors.
How long should I wait before expecting new growth after fixing care issues?
After correcting light, soil, and timing errors, expect the first new leaf within 10–21 days during active season (spring/summer). In dormancy (winter), wait until March—even with perfect care, growth won’t resume until photoperiod exceeds 11 hours. Patience isn’t passive; it’s trusting the plant’s biological clock.
Common Myths Debunked
Myth 1: “Rubber plants grow slowly—that’s normal.”
False. While not explosive growers like pothos, healthy indoor rubber plants produce 1–2 new leaves per month during active season. Stalled growth for >6 weeks indicates suboptimal conditions—not species temperament. Wild Ficus elastica grows 2–3 feet per year in ideal settings.
Myth 2: “More fertilizer = faster growth.”
Dangerous. Excess nitrogen burns roots and inhibits phosphorus uptake—critical for root development and energy transfer. University of Illinois Extension trials showed plants fed at 2x recommended strength grew 37% slower and developed 5x more chlorosis than controls.
